Course Details

Introduction to Bio-Inspired Ceramics: Origins, principles, and applications
Biomimetic Design: Learning from nature to create advanced ceramic materials
Bioactive Ceramics: Interactions with living tissues and biological systems
Nanostructured Ceramics: Synthesis, properties, and applications
Functionally Graded Ceramics: Tailored properties for specialized uses
Bio-Inspired Ceramic Coatings: Enhancing surfaces for durability and functionality
Biodegradable Ceramics: Controlled degradation for targeted applications
Advanced Ceramic Processing Techniques: Innovative methods for creating bio-inspired materials
Applications of Bio-Inspired Ceramics: Case studies in biomedicine, energy, and environmental protection
